История веб-браузера Opera

редактировать

MultiTorg Opera

История веб-браузера Opera началось в 1994 году, когда оно было начато как исследовательский проект в Telenor, крупнейшей норвежской телекоммуникационной компании. В 1995 году проект был выделен в отдельную компанию под названием Opera Software ASA, с первой общедоступной версией, выпущенной в 1996 году. Opera претерпела обширные изменения и улучшения, а также представила важные функции. например, Быстрый набор.

До версии 2.0 браузер Opera назывался MultiTorg Opera (версия 1.0) и имел только ограниченный внутренний выпуск - хотя он был публично продемонстрирован на Третьей Международной конференции WWW в апреле 1995 года. Он был известен своим многодокументным интерфейсом (MDI) и «горячим списком» (боковая панель), что значительно упростило просмотр нескольких страниц одновременно, а также первым браузером, полностью сосредоточившимся на соблюдении Стандарты W3C.

В феврале 2013 года Opera Software объявила, что их собственный движок рендеринга Presto будет постепенно заменен на WebKit. В Opera 15 браузер был полностью переписан, причем этот и последующие выпуски были основаны на Blink и Chromium.

Содержание

  • 1 Настольные версии
    • 1.1 Версия 2
    • 1.2 Версия 3
    • 1.3 Версия 4
    • 1.4 Версия 5
    • 1.5 Версия 6
    • 1.6 Первые разногласия по поводу MSN.com
    • 1.7 Версия 7
    • 1,8 Вторые разногласия по поводу MSN.com
    • 1.9 Разногласия с Hotmail
    • 1.10 Версия 8
    • 1.11 Версия 9
    • 1.12 Версия 10
    • 1.13 Версия 11
    • 1.14 Версия 12
    • 1.15 Opera 2013
    • 1.16 Opera 2014
    • 1.17 Opera 2015
    • 1.18 Opera 2016
    • 1.19 Opera 2017
    • 1.20 Opera 2018
    • 1.21 Opera 2019
    • 1.22 Opera 2020
  • 2 График выпуска выпусков
  • 3 Совместимость выпусков
  • 4 Снятые с производства версии для устройств
    • 4.1 Opera Mobile Classic
    • 4.2 Интернет-канал для Wii
    • 4.3 Браузер Nintendo DS
  • 5 Ссылки
  • 6 Внешние ссылки

Настольные версии

Версия 2

Версия 2.0, первый общедоступный выпуск Opera, была выпущена как условно-бесплатная в 1996 году.

D По многочисленным просьбам Opera Software проявила интерес к программированию своего браузера для альтернативных операционных систем, таких как Apple Macintosh, QNX и BeOS. 10 октября 1997 года они запустили проект «Магия проекта» - попытка определить, кто захочет приобрести копию своего браузера в их родной ОС, и правильно распределить средства на разработку или аутсорсинг таких операционных систем. 30 ноября 1997 г. они закрыли голосование по вопросу о том, с какой операционной системой разрабатывать. Project Magic затем стал колонкой новостей для обновлений для альтернативных операционных систем до версии 4.

Версия 3

Opera 3.62 Просмотр Opera в Windows 9x

Opera 3 была первой версией Opera с Поддержка JavaScript, но Java все еще отсутствует. Он был выпущен для нескольких операционных систем 31 декабря 1997 года.

В 1998 году была выпущена Opera 3.5, добавляющая поддержку каскадных таблиц стилей (CSS) и возможность загрузки файлов.

Начиная с версии 3.5, Opera поддерживает CSS, и Хокон Виум Ли, один из изобретателей CSS, является техническим директором в Opera. До 6.0 Opera поддерживала наиболее распространенные веб-стандарты, плагины Netscape и некоторые другие недавние стандарты, такие как WAP и WML для беспроводных устройств, но реализовала расширенный ECMAScript (из которых «JavaScript» является реализацией) и HTML объектная модель документа была плохой.

Версия 3.6 была выпущена 12 мая 1999 года. 16-разрядная версия Opera для Windows 3.62 была последней версией, доступной для Windows 3.x и NT 3.x. Для последующих выпусков потребуется Windows 95.

Версия 4

28 июня 2000 года была выпущена Opera 4 для Windows (Elektra), в которой было представлено новое кроссплатформенное ядро ​​, и новый интегрированный почтовый клиент.

Версия 5

Opera 5.02 в Windows XP

Opera 5, выпущенная 6 декабря 2000 г., была первой версией, которая спонсировалась рекламой вместо испытательного срока. Версия 5 также поддерживала ICQ, но она была удалена из более поздних версий.

Opera впервые поддержала OS / 2, требуя установки и Odin.

Opera 5.10 (апрель 2001 г.) была первой версия для распознавания жестов мыши, но по умолчанию эта функция отключена.

Версия 6

Opera 6.0

29 ноября 2001 г. была выпущена Opera 6 с новыми функциями, включая поддержку Unicode и предлагающую однодокументный интерфейс, а также многодокументный интерфейс, разрешенный в предыдущих версиях.

Первые разногласия по поводу MSN.com

24 октября 2001 г. Microsoft заблокировала пользователям других браузеров, кроме Internet Explorer, включая Opera, получить доступ к MSN.com. После криков о монополистическом поведении Microsoft сняла ограничения через два дня. Однако даже в ноябре 2001 г. пользователи Opera по-прежнему были заблокированы для доступа к некоторому контенту MSN.com, несмотря на способность Opera отображать контент, если он был обслужен.

Версия 7

Opera 7.02

Вкл. 28 января 2003 г. была выпущена Opera 7, в которой был представлен новый механизм компоновки «Presto » с улучшенным CSS, клиентскими сценариями и объектной моделью документа (DOM) поддержка. Поддержка Mac OS 9 прекращена.

В версии 7.0 Opera претерпела обширную переработку с использованием более быстрого и мощного механизма компоновки Presto. Новый движок обеспечил почти полную поддержку HTML DOM, что означает, что части или целая страница могут быть повторно отображены в ответ на события DOM и сценария.

Обзор 2004 года в The Washington Post описал Opera 7.5 как чрезмерно сложную и трудную в использовании. Обзор также подверг критике использование бесплатной версии навязчивой рекламы, когда другие браузеры, такие как Mozilla и Safari, предлагались бесплатно без рекламы.

В августе 2004 г. Opera 7.6 начала ограниченное альфа-тестирование. У него была более продвинутая поддержка стандартов и была введена поддержка голоса для Opera, а также поддержка голосового XML. Opera также анонсировала новый браузер для интерактивного телевидения, который включает опцию подгонки по ширине Opera 8. Fit to Width - это технология, которая изначально использовала мощь CSS, но теперь это внутренняя технология Opera. Страницы динамически изменяют размер, уменьшая изображения и / или текст, и даже удаляя изображения с определенными размерами, чтобы они соответствовали любой ширине экрана, что значительно улучшает работу на небольших экранах. Opera 7.6 никогда официально не выпускалась в качестве окончательной версии.

12 января 2005 г. Opera Software объявила, что будет предлагать бесплатные лицензии высшим учебным заведениям, что является изменением по сравнению с предыдущей стоимостью 1000 долларов США за неограниченные лицензии. Бесплатную лицензию выбрали следующие школы: Массачусетский технологический институт (MIT), Гарвардский университет, Оксфордский университет, Технологический институт Джорджии и Университет Дьюка. Opera часто подвергалась критике за спонсорскую рекламу, поскольку это рассматривалось как препятствие на пути к завоеванию доли рынка. В более новых версиях пользователю был разрешен выбор общих графических баннеров или текстовой целевой рекламы, предоставляемой Google на основе просматриваемой страницы. Пользователи могут заплатить лицензионный сбор за удаление рекламной панели.

Второй спор относительно MSN.com

В 2003 году MSN.com был настроен для представления браузерам Opera с таблицей стилей, используемых для старых версий Microsoft Internet Explorer. Другие браузеры получили либо адаптированную под них таблицу стилей, либо, по крайней мере, последнюю таблицу стилей Internet Explorer. Устаревшая таблица стилей, которую получила Opera, заставила Opera переместить значительную часть содержимого MSN.com на 30 пикселей влево от того места, где он должен быть, искажая страницу и создавая впечатление, будто в ней есть ошибка. Opera.

В ответ компания Opera Software создала специальную версию Opera «Bork », которая отображала тарабарщину вместо MSN.com, но не на любом другом сайте. сайт. Они сказали, что сделали это, чтобы подчеркнуть необходимость гармоничных отношений между веб-браузерами и веб-сайтами.

После жалоб Microsoft изменила свои серверы, чтобы представить последнюю версию Opera, версию 7, с Таблица стилей обслуживалась последней версией Internet Explorer, что устранило проблему. Однако Microsoft продолжала использовать устаревшую таблицу стилей для более старой Opera 6.

Противоречие с Hotmail

В ноябре 2004 года Opera Software отправила электронное сообщение на Microsoft с жалобой на то, что пользователям Opera был отправлен неполный файл JavaScript при использовании Hotmail (теперь Outlook.com). Неполный файл не позволял пользователям Opera очищать свои папки «Нежелательная почта». Позднее компания Opera Software отправила в Microsoft физическое письмо. Тем не менее, по состоянию на 11 февраля 2005 г. Microsoft не ответила на сообщения и не устранила проблему.

Версия 8

Opera 8.0 в Windows XP
Викиновости имеют новости по теме:

19 апреля 2005 года была выпущена версия 8.0. Помимо поддержки SVG крошечных мультимодальных функций и пользовательского JavaScript, пользовательский интерфейс по умолчанию был очищен и упрощен. Домашняя страница по умолчанию была улучшенным поисковым порталом. Изменения вызвали недовольство ряда существующих пользователей, поскольку некоторые дополнительные настройки были скрыты.

В версии 8.0 появилась поддержка Scalable Vector Graphics (SVG) 1.1 Tiny. Это был первый крупный веб-браузер, изначально поддерживающий некоторую форму SVG.

Версия 8.5 была выпущена 20 сентября 2005 года. Opera объявила, что их браузер будет доступен бесплатно и без рекламы, хотя компания по-прежнему продолжали продавать контракты на поддержку. Улучшения включали автоматическое исправление на стороне клиента веб-сайтов, которые отображались некорректно, и ряд исправлений безопасности.

Версия 9

Opera 9 Просмотр Википедии на базе MediaWiki в Linux на рабочем столе GNOME 2

Версия 9.0 была первым браузером Microsoft Windows, GNU / Linux и BSD, прошедшим Acid2 тест. Эта версия, выпущенная 20 июня 2006 г., добавила XSLT и улучшила SVG до базового уровня 1.1.

Бета-версии Opera 9 включали пасхальное яйцо, которое при срабатывании влияет на тест Acid2. После того, как страница будет открыта в течение некоторого времени, глаза смайлика будут следовать за курсором, и когда пользователь щелкает по глазам, предупреждение JavaScript будет читать «Потому что просто передать недостаточно;)». Изменения в коде Acid2 были применены с помощью функции Opera browser.js и остаются доступными в отдельном файле пользовательского JavaScript.

Opera представила виджеты, небольшие веб-приложения, встроенный BitTorrent-клиент, улучшенная блокировка контента и встроенный инструмент для создания и редактирования поисковых систем. Opera также добавила возможность читать MHTML и сохранять веб-страницу в виде архивов.

Версия 9.1 (выпущенная в 2006 г.) представила защиту от мошенничества с использованием технологии GeoTrust, поставщика цифровых сертификатов, и PhishTank, организации, которая отслеживает известные фишинговые веб-сайты.

Версия 9.2, кодовое название Merlin, представила Быстрый набор, 3 × 3 маленьких эскиза, которые отображаются вместо пустая страница.

Версия 9.5 под кодовым названием Kestrel (после Kestrel сокола) была выпущена, чтобы преодолеть разрыв между Opera 9.2 и Opera 10. Она включала некоторые улучшения рендеринга, которые должны быть сделаны в Opera 10, а также была направлена ​​на обеспечение лучшей интеграции с различными операционными системами. Первая альфа версия Opera 9.5 была выпущена 4 сентября 2007 года. Первая публичная бета была выпущена 25 октября 2007 года, а финальная версия была выпущена 12 июня 2008 года.. Финальный выпуск был загружен более 4,5 миллионов раз за первые 5 дней.

В Opera 9.5 улучшена поддержка каскадных таблиц стилей (CSS), включая многие другие селекторы CSS3 и CSS2. text-shadowсвойство. Также была улучшена поддержка других веб-стандартов. Например, реализация Scalable Vector Graphics (SVG) Opera 9.5 поддерживает 93,8% набора тестов SVG W3C и встроенную поддержку Animated Portable Network. Графика (APNG) и MathML. Opera 9.5 также поддерживает высокий уровень безопасности сертификаты расширенной проверки и дополнительную защиту от вредоносных программ благодаря партнерству с.

. Интерфейс также претерпел несколько изменений: по умолчанию используется «Sharp», новый скин разработан, чтобы быть более интуитивно понятным, хотя классический скин все еще был доступен в качестве предпочтений пользователя. Поддержка программы чтения с экрана была снова добавлена. Почтовый клиент Opera, Opera Mail, был обновлен с улучшенной функцией индексирования и множеством исправлений. Opera 9.5 также позволяет пользователям сохранять закладки, заметки, персональную панель и настройки быстрого набора в службу Opera Link. Затем эти настройки можно синхронизировать с другим браузером Opera, например, с копией Opera Mini, запущенной на мобильном телефоне.

Наряду с новыми функциями Opera 9.5 имела новые улучшения производительности. Например, x64 -битные версии Opera для совместимых операционных систем Linux и BSD. С другой стороны, поддержка SPARC Linux была прекращена.

Версия 9.6 улучшила Opera Link с новой возможностью синхронизации пользовательских поисковых систем и истории ввода. Предварительный просмотр ленты и обновленный клиент Opera Mail были дополнительными изменениями.

Версия 10

Версия 10 (Peregrine) дебютировала в первой бета-версии 3 июня2009 г. и набрала 100/100 в тесте Acid3, но не прошла гладкость критерии. Также была предварительная сборка с оценкой 100/100, выпущенная 28 марта 2009 года. Среди других функций она также включала оптимизацию скорости, встроенную проверку орфографии для форм, функцию автоматического обновления, форматирование почты HTML, веб-шрифты и шрифт SVG. Поддержка альфа-прозрачности с использованием цветовых моделей RGBA и HSLA, а также обновленная версия веб-отладчика Opera Dragonfly. Был представлен режим Opera Turbo, в котором серверы Opera используются в качестве прокси-серверов со сжатием данных, что сокращает объем передаваемых данных до 80% (в зависимости от содержимого) и, таким образом, увеличивает скорость.

Opera 10 была официально выпущена 1 сентября 2009 года. В течение недели после выпуска было зарегистрировано 10 миллионов загрузок.

Версии 10.5x (под кодовым названием Evenes) также поставлялись с новым движком JavaScript, Carakan, и новым графическим сервером, получившим название Vega (заменяющим ранее использовавшийся Qt), что увеличило его скорость. измеримо. Затем версия 10.60, которая, по утверждениям Opera Software, на 50% быстрее, чем Opera 10.50, в которой также появились новые функции, такие как Геолокация, поддержка WebM, AVG защита от вредоносных программ, улучшения быстрого набора и т. Д.

10.63 была последней версией для работы в Windows 9x / NT4, поскольку для более поздних выпусков потребуется как минимум Windows 2000.

Версия 11

Opera 11 (под кодовым названием Kjevik) была выпущена 16 декабря 2010 года с новыми функциями, включая расширения, размещение вкладок, визуальные жесты мыши, новый установщик (только для Windows) и улучшения безопасности в поле адреса. Кроме того, список блокировщиков контента теперь можно синхронизировать через Opera Link. Он также прошел тест Acid3 с 22 января 2011 года.

12 апреля 2011 года была выпущена Opera 11.10 (кодовое название Barracuda). Он содержит множество исправлений «под капотом», таких как улучшенный режим Turbo Mode, мастер установки подключаемого модуля и переписанный Speed ​​Dial. Opera 11.10 была обновлена ​​для использования нового механизма рендеринга Presto 2.8.

18 мая 2011 года была выпущена финальная версия Opera 11.11 с улучшениями безопасности.

28 июня 2011 года была выпущена Opera 11.50 (кодовое имя Swordfish). Оснащенный механизмом рендеринга Presto 2.9.168, который обеспечивает до 20% ускорение рендеринга CSS и SVG, поддержку тега HTML5

6 декабря 2011 г. была выпущена Opera 11.60 (кодовое имя Tunny). Обновленный с помощью новейшего движка рендеринга Presto 2.10.229, это обновление включает несколько изменений, включая обновленный пользовательский интерфейс интерфейса электронной почты, новое поле адреса с функцией звездочки и несколько скрытых под капотом новых тегов HTML5 и реализаций синтаксического анализа, полный ECMAScript 5.1 поддержка. В этой версии также реализовано географическое местоположение JSON API Google.

24 января 2012 г. была выпущена Opera 11.61 с улучшенными функциями безопасности и стабильности.

27 марта 2012 г. Opera 11.62 был выпущен с улучшениями безопасности и стабильности, исправлениями ошибок и улучшением производительности.

17 апреля 2012 года была выпущена Opera 11.63. Это был эксклюзивный выпуск для Mac, вопреки мнению, что Apple преждевременно щелкнула выключателем, сделав этот выпуск доступным для пользователей Mac раньше, чем для пользователей Windows и Linux.

10 мая 2012 года была выпущена Opera 11.64, со стабильностью, исправлениями ошибок и улучшениями безопасности

Версия 12

7 июня 2011 года Opera выпустила версию 12 Pre-Alpha Build 1017. Ее кодовое название было Wahoo. Opera 12 имеет аппаратное ускорение, поддержку WebGL и новую функцию Opera Reader.

13 октября 2011 года была выпущена альфа-версия 12, сборка 1105. Включает несколько улучшений скорости и памяти, реализацию тем, полное аппаратное ускорение с помощью WebGL, полное соответствие ECMAScript 5.1 и новый синтаксический анализатор HTML5 под названием Ragnarök.

7 июня 2012 г. была выпущена версия Opera build 1448 RC1. Он предлагает встроенную поддержку 64-битных версий и внешние плагины.

14 июня 2012 года была выпущена финальная версия Opera 12.00.

Opera 12.01 с некоторыми незначительными, но важными обновлениями безопасности и стабильности была выпущена 2 августа 2012 года.

Opera 12.02, выпущенная 30 августа 2012 года, была последней версией, которая запускалась в Windows 2000. Для последующих версий потребуется как минимум Windows XP и Server 2003.

5 ноября 2012 года была выпущена Opera 12.10 с

Последняя правка сделана 2021-05-23 03:04:14
Содержание доступно по лицензии CC BY-SA 3.0 (если не указано иное).
Обратная связь: support@alphapedia.ru
Соглашение
О проекте